Extract from the Western Australian Parliamentary Handbook

MARSHALL, Magenta Rose, MLA
Member for Rockingham
Australian Labor Party


PARLIAMENTARY SERVICE

Elected to the Forty-First Parliament for Rockingham at the by-election on 29 July 2023, held to fill the vacancy consequent upon the resignation of Hon. Mark McGowan.

Parliamentary Appointments

Acting Speaker of the Legislative Assembly from 12 March 2024.

Standing Committees

Member, Joint Standing Committee on Delegated Legislation from 10 August 2023.




PERSONAL

Birth

Born 14 December 1994, Western Australia.

Qualifications and occupation before entering Parliament

BA (Asian Studies and Politics and International Relations; Indonesian).
Union Membership Engagement Officer; Electorate Officer; WA Labor Campaign Director


ROCKINGHAM - ELECTORATE PROFILE

The electorate of Rockingham is located in the South Metropolitan Region and includes all or parts of the City of Rockingham.

Comprising of all or parts of the localities of Cooloongup, East Rockingham, Garden Island, Hillman, Peron, Rockingham, Safety Bay, Shoalwater and Waikiki.

Enrolment - 29,259 (11 February 2021)

Area - 49 km²
